  4. Five Little Monkeys (book)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Five_Little_Monkeys_(book)

    Five Little Monkeys received good reviews. Kirkus Reviews stated, "Her pictures are big, splashy, and angular. The monkeys look as though they are made of electric charged pipe cleaners, and the overall effect epitomizes the humorous side of jungle life." [2] The New York Times said the book "will give a great deal of pleasure to small humans." [3]

  8. Juliet Kepes -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Juliet_Kepes

    In the early 1950s, Kepes began writing and illustrating children's book. Her first work was published in 1952 and was titled Five Little Monkeys.The work was good enough to win a Caldecott Medal honour in 1953, missing out on the medal to The Biggest Bear by Lynd Ward.
